Abstract/Contents:Presents a trial "established to demonstrate which herbicide active ingredients have enough safety to be used on creeping bentgrass." States that "bentgrass at fairway height may be uninjured from herbicides that may severely injury [injure] bentgrass at putting green height." Lists herbicides used in the trial, including Lontrel and Quicksilver. Concludes that "Quicksilver provides excellent control of silvery thread moss...[but] does not control dandelion or white clover...Lontrel should be given strong consideration...for controlling broadleaf weeds."
